Is noone else getting this error since updating cygwin about a month ago?
Nothing has changed in the CVSROOT/CVSROOT directory, the only thing I did
was update to cygwin 1.3.12 from 1.3.10.

Maybe noone else has a CVS archive set up via a windows shared folder?  The
error is displayed with any cvs usage.

Its not too dangerous an error as cvs still works, but it is an annoying
glitch.  I've tried opening up the config file and putting in windows-style
carriage returns (it only had linefeeds in there) but it still reports the
error.

So what changed with regards to mounted shares between 1.3.10 and 1.3.12?
I'm sure someone will say it is in binary mode, but how do I change the mode
of an auto-mounted net share like //my-server?  Basically, I want to change
the auto-mount mode to binary I think?
